MGMT 453 - Labor And Employment Law

Description: | A study of the common law and statutory law affecting union-management relations, with emphasis on current labor legislation including such areas as the National Labor Relations Act and amendments, the Railway Labor Act, wage and hour legislation, workmen's compensation, unemployment compensation, Occupational Health and Safety Acts and social security laws. |
